Major 7.2 magnitude earthquake hits Chile

889 Views
0 Replies
1 min read
A major earthquake of 7.2 magnitude hit central Chile on Sunday, the US Geological Survey said.

The epicenter was 60 miles (96 km) northwest of Temuco at a depth of 20.5 miles, it said.

"No destructive widespread tsunami threat exists based on historical and tsunami data," said the Hawaii-based Tsunami Center.

Chile, the world's top copper producer, has seen its economy surge on the heavy spending to rebuild cities ravaged by a quake in February last year and record prices for its main export.
